This is a separate visitors attraction. They are the only wild cattle in the world, sole survivors of herds that once roamed the forests of Britain. Once they were held sacred and pre-Christian pagans sacrificed them to their gods. Later in their history, this herd both defended and fed the Castle. These animals are still potentially dangerous and only visit them with the Warden.
The Warden will take you as close as safely possible and explain their more recent history and way of life. Remember, they are more rare than any endangered Panda or Mountain Gorilla, and are simply the only wild cattle in the world. They have their own website which is
